A client who has been training at high intensities in preparation for a triathlon reports joint pain, excess fatigue, and the in

ability to sustain normal workouts. In which stage of the general adaptation syndrome is this client?Select one:a. Alarm reactionb. Exhaustion c. Overtrainingd. Resistance development

Answer:

The correct answer to the following question is option B) Exhaustion .

Explanation:

The general adaptation syndrome can be described as 3 stage response , that body has to stress. These are alarm reaction, resistance and exhaustion. Exhaustion is the third stage in the general adaptation syndrome, where the body has already lost its energy resources by continuously trying but the body is not able to recover from the first alarm reaction stage. In this stage body is no longer able to fight the stress.
